Bitget Wallet, a self-custodial cryptocurrency finance app, has launched its Dollar Card in South Africa, allowing users to spend stablecoins directly at merchants worldwide without needing a separate exchange or third-party transfer. The card converts USDC holdings into South African rand at the point of sale, enabling everyday purchases at major retailers including Pick 'n Pay, Shoprite, and restaurant chains such as Nando's and KFC. To mark the launch, eligible users will earn 8% cashback on grocery and dining purchases up to $200 per month starting 6 May 2026, as the company positions the service as a practical solution to currency volatility and costly cross-border payments across African markets.
